Acceptance Rate and Application Statistics

The following table compares the admission related statistics including number of applicants, admitted, and enrolled between selected colleges. The average acceptance rate of selected colleges is 68.87% and the average admission yield (enrollment rate) is 10.22%.
The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art has the tighest (lowest) acceptance rate of 22.47% and Beth Hamedrash Shaarei Yosher Institute has the highest yield (enrollment rate) of 100.00% among selected colleges. The numbers in parenthesis() in below table represent the number and rate by gender (men/women). The stat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023.

SAT Scores Comparison

The average SAT score of selected colleges is 1345. By subject, the average score of the SAT EBRW(Evidence-based Reading and Writing) is 660 and the average SAT Math score is 685.
The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art has the highest SAT scores of 1,470 and Adelphi University has the lowest SAT scores of 1,220 among selected colleges. The following table compares SAT Scores between selected colleges for the academic year 2022-2023.
